7 ways to increase intimacy with your lover without getting physical

​Non-sexual ways to increase intimacy

If you thought having sex with your partner is the only way to get intimate with him or her, then you might be wrong. Intimacy in a relationship is not limited to getting physical and sometimes, a partner’s sweet gestures can do wonders. Here are some simple and non-sexual ways to come closer to your significant other and strengthen your relationship.

2/8

​A romantic dinner

Instead of heading to a high-end restaurant, cook your lover’s favourite meal at home. Dress up, switch off the lights, play some music and put on some aromatic candles. After exchanging some sweet nothings over a hearty meal, go for a stroll or play some romantic song and slow dance with your partner. We bet it would turn out to be a night to remember.

​What about a massage?

Take your partner by surprise by giving him or her a sensual back or foot massage. Look for the basic massage techniques online, thrown in some aromatic oils, sprinkle rose petals on the bed and let your moves do all the talking.

​Handwritten letter

The charm of a handwritten love letter is still irreplaceable in today’s world. Think about what makes you fall in love with your partner every day, when was the first time you realised he or she is the one and share the same idea of a future of togetherness. Now, pour all your feelings in a letter. We assure you, this gesture, which is better than any expensive gift, would increase your emotional intimacy.

​Series of sweet texts

If writing a letter is not your cup of tea, here’s another alternative. Select a day and send multiple texts (preferable one every hour) to your partner, each one giving a new reason why he or she is the perfect partner for you. Fill your message with details and end the day with a surprise gift.

​Try doing your partner’s favourite activity

Does your partner love painting? Does he or she go to play tennis every evening? Or, loves dancing? Well, try doing your partner's favourite activity for a day. It would give you a chance to connect with him or her over a new thing, spend quality time together and make happy memories.

​Pretend that you just met!

In case you both have been dating for quite some time, you can try re-enacting your first date. Go to that same place again, order the same food and pretend you have just met. You might laugh thinking how shy you were when your relationship started and feel proud thinking how long you both have come together.

​Practice gratitude

This is something that would help to strengthen the foundation of your relationship and bring you both emotionally closer. Look for reasons to express gratitude to your partner every night before sleeping. It could be washing the clothes, helping in household chores, planning a vacation or simply cooking a nice meal that morning, no partner hates being appreciated.
